Self-Help vs. Storytelling: Choosing the Right Book for Emotional Well-Being Growth

Books have long been a source of wisdom and healing. Whether through structured guidance or deeply personal narratives, they provide comfort and clarity in times of emotional distress. But when choosing a book for emotional well-being growth, should you opt for self-help or storytelling?
Self-help books provide practical steps for your journey of self-improvement, while storybooks offer a vicarious read to heal the heart. Knowing the differences-between the two-and knowing how they coexist will help you make the right choice in your journey toward emotional stability.

What Defines a Self-Help Book for Emotional Well-Being Growth?
Self-help books can actually serve as road maps for self-improvement. They usually have practical advice about personal development exercises and proven strategies for emotional healing. Most books usually draw on psychology, neuroscience, and personal experience to help readers really overcome emotional hurdles and develop resilience.
Such books show how to apply the author’s material to real life instead of having fictional twists to them. They comprise:
- Guided exercises: Journaling prompts, affirmations, and other thought-provoking questions for encouraging self-reflection.
- Psychological Insights: Scientific facts on mental health, emotional intelligence, and behavioral patterns.
- Actionable steps: Step-by-step techniques on how to overcome worry and stress and even prevent negative emotions from taking root.

How Storytelling Books Foster Emotional Healing
A story can move people in a different way. For instance, through fiction or memoirs, storytelling books create an emotional connection that even self-help books can lack. This does not give advice directly but rather makes them see themselves as characters and stories-in-progress and feel much more personal healing.
With self-help books, story telling involves letting people know that they are not alone instead of telling them what all to do. Often, when a person reads the journey of another through pain, trauma, or self-discovery, that person will find comfort in knowing that he or she is not alone on that journey because healing is possible.

- At this stage of your emotional evolution, you must establish whether you are leaning more toward self-help or toward storytelling.
- Opt for self-help if you are looking for a little structure in your work. For direct strategies on emotional growth, self-help books have very exact exercises designed to allow you to take full charge of your emotions.
- Select storytelling if you want the comfort of connection. If you find solace in shared experiences, books with a narrative focus provide validation and inspiration.
- Self-help works if you want to get right into it. These books break healing down into very practical steps you can implement today.
- If you favor a more gradual approach to healing, storytelling may work better for you. Fiction and memoirs allow you to acquire lessons through emotion rather than through instruction.
- Ultimately, they each have unique strengths, and choosing whichever resonates for you is the clincher.
Blending Both: A Holistic Approach to Emotional Well-Being Growth
The fullest healing experience can teach a person both self-help and stories-they are really powerful together. Real healing is not merely moving out. It is understanding the motive emotions behind movement fixes. Such an approach would be:
- Read self-help books for techniques while reading storybooks to gain emotional depth.
- Write journal entries as personal reflections on what you learned in both styles.
- Practice self-compassion- use the characters as mirrors through which to apply insights from self-help techniques.
